The modern LGBTQ+ rights movement didn't start with corporate Pride parades. It started with riots. And leading that charge were trans women, particularly trans women of color like and Sylvia Rivera . At the Stonewall Inn in 1969, it was the most marginalized—the homeless, the drag queens, the trans sex workers—who fought back against police brutality.
